


Spitz is a 3G/4G dual-band wireless router, widely used for smart home and IoT area. Running OpenWRT OS, you can compile your own firmware to fit for different application scenarios. It has built-in mini PCIe 3G/4G module to support different operators and can be used all over the world.
Spitz (GL-X750V2) is the advanced version of Spitz (GL-X750). It comes with the redesigned PCBA and optimized antennas to improve the 4G performance.

Spitz creates a secure network for devices that process sensitive information such as ATMs, Point-of-Sales (POS) and more, encrypting their 4G LTE or Wi-Fi traffic via a VPN tunnel for secure access to the Internet or remote services.
Spitz router is easily configurable and has a built-in interchangeable module for full optimization. It is compatible with CAT4 and CAT6 modules from various brands.

DNS over TLS is a security protocol for encrypting and wrapping Domain Name System (DNS) queries and answers via the Transport Layer Security (TLS) protocol. The goal of the method is to increase user privacy and security by preventing eavesdropping and manipulation of DNS data via man-in-the-middle attacks.

Experience seamless connectivity with the Spitz※, fully compatible with GL.iNet’s advanced eSIM solution, which supports both physical eSIM cards and integrated eSIM chips. eSIMs can be programmed remotely, offering unmatched convenience, flexibility, space-saving, and enhanced security. For consumers, this means effortlessly switching networks and avoiding roaming charges, while businesses benefit from centralized management, multi-device support, and secure data management.
※Products with Quectel EP06-A modules do NOT support eSIM, as the Qualcomm software lacks specific AT command support. For products with EP06-E modules, please refer to this LINK to upgrade to the latest firmware and enable eSIM functionality.

| Interface |
1 x WAN Ethernet port 1 x LAN Ethernet port 5 x LEDs 1 x USB 2.0 port 1 x Micro SIM card slot 1 x MicroSD card slot (Up to 128GB) 1 x Reset Button |
| CPU | QCA9531@650MHz |
| Memory / Storage | DDR2 128MB / NOR Flash 16MB |
| Protocol | IEEE 802.11a/b/g/n/ac |
| 3G/4G Mini PCIe Module | Support CAT4/CAT6 Mini PCIe |
| Wi-Fi Speed | 300Mbps (2.4GHz), 433Mbps (5GHz) |
| 4G LTE Antennas | 2 x detachable external antennas (SMA, 700M~2700MHz) |
| Wi-Fi Antennas | 2dBi 5G & 2.4G internal antennas |
| TX power | <20dBm |
| Ethernet Speed | 10/100Mbps |
| LEDs | Power / 2.4G Wi-Fi / 5G Wi-Fi / 4G / WAN |
| Power Input | DC4017, 12V/1.5A (4.0*1.7mm) |
| Power Consumption | <6W |
| Operating Temperature | -20~40°C (-4~104°F) |
| Storage Temperature | -20~70°C (-4~158°F) |
| Dimension / Weight | 115 x 74 x 22mm / 86g |
